
Housing costs in Statesville?
A typical home costs
$239,300, which is 29.2% less exp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 17.3% less expensive than the average North Carolina home, at
$289,300.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Statesville costs
$900 per month, which is 18.9% cheaper than the national average of
$1,110 and 38.9% cheaper than the state average of
$1,250.
Can I afford Statesville?
To live comfortably in Statesville (zip 28677), North Carolina, a minimum annual income of
$45,720 for a family, and
$31,600 for a single person is recommended.
